Output 583e10a0589f67187c7701973a87a52a12da8984dfd6877c893b1db05f739137:72

value
1366240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e4ca942ee5a531e42e6b148b3cb2575272110d2 OP_EQUALVERIFY OP_CHECKSIG
address
1891YUY7wXZonyfTQFjr9Nu9LGCQF28N3U
transaction
583e10a0589f67187c7701973a87a52a12da8984dfd6877c893b1db05f739137
spent
true